WebCodecs Video Rendering

High-Performance Video Rendering in the Browser

WebCodecs video rendering gives modern web apps direct access to browser media primitives for efficient decoding and frame handling. It helps teams build smoother playback, lower-latency experiences, and more responsive video workflows without relying on heavier abstractions.

For products where timing, quality, and control matter, WebCodecs can improve how video is rendered on screen. That makes it a strong fit for interactive media, streaming interfaces, and real-time visual applications.

Why Teams Choose WebCodecs Video Rendering

Traditional browser video pipelines can limit control over how frames are decoded, processed, and displayed. WebCodecs video rendering gives developers a more direct path to manage video data, helping optimize performance for specific product needs.

This added control supports custom rendering logic, tighter synchronization, and more predictable behavior across advanced use cases. For teams building media-heavy web products, that flexibility can translate into a better user experience.

Built for Real-Time and Interactive Use Cases

WebCodecs video rendering is well suited to applications where delay and responsiveness directly affect usability. It can support real-time streaming interfaces, live collaboration tools, cloud gaming experiences, and browser-based editors that need efficient frame handling.

By working closer to the browser’s media capabilities, teams can create pipelines that feel faster and more precise. This is especially valuable when video is part of a larger interactive workflow rather than simple passive playback.

More Control Across the Rendering Pipeline

A key advantage of WebCodecs video rendering is the ability to integrate decoding and rendering into broader application logic. Developers can coordinate video frames with canvas rendering, graphics workflows, or custom processing stages to match product requirements.

This makes it easier to build tailored experiences instead of forcing video into a one-size-fits-all player model. The result is a rendering approach that can better align with product goals, interface behavior, and performance priorities.
